This book is a testament to the complex women and men of the Viking Age, a time often characterized by the exploits of its warrior kings. While the men sailed the seas and clashed in battle, it was often the women who held their societies together, who managed their resources, ensured the continuity of their lineage and the stability of their clans, and who influenced the destinies of their families and their kingdoms. Their roles often extended beyond the domestic sphere, influencing decisions on war and peace, shaping political strategies and building alliances. Their voices, though silenced by the passing of time and the limitations of historical records, reverberate through the centuries. Credit: Squibler

In the frozen lands of the North, where the sea's icy embrace meets towering cliffs and sprawling fjords, the saga of the Norse unfolds. Here, the air is thick with the scent of salt and pine, and the skies are alive with the whispers of ancient gods. This is a land ruled by iron wills, unyielding blades, and the favor of deities who watch over their mortal kin. At the heart of this tale are the Northern People, feared and reviled by the Christian kingdoms to the south, who call them "heathens" and "barbarians." To the Christians, they are marauders from a savage land, bringers of chaos and fire. But among their own, these Vikings are warriors, explorers, and farmers, bound by honor, loyalty, and a destiny shaped by the gods themselves. Their ships, sleek and swift, carry them across the seas to trade, raid, and explore lands far beyond their frozen homeland
